    What do the three Rs in the 3R Principle stand for?
    Question

    What do the three Rs in the 3R Principle stand
    for?

    A.

    Reduce, Reuse, Recover

    B.

    Reduce, Recover, Recycle

    C.

    Recover, Reuse, Recycle

    D.

    Reduce, Reuse, Recycle

    Correct option is D

    The 3R principle is a method of waste management that stands for Reduce, Reuse and Recycle.
    Reduce: This step involves reducing the amount of waste generation by using fewer disposable items.
    Reuse: This step involves reusing items for other purposes. For example, small bottles can be cleaned
    and used to store food items in the kitchen.
    Recycle: In this step, waste material is destroyed and the remains of the item are used to make something else. For example, used plastic plates can be melted and reshaped into plastic bottles.
